On Wednesday 30 March 2011 10:07:11 Eric Bollengier wrote: > Hello Philipp, > > Le dimanche 27 mars 2011 11:03:24, Philipp Storz a écrit : > > Hello bacula developers, > > > > we found that the bacula start scripts do not start the bacula daemons > > with the parameters for user and group. > > As a result, the daemons always run as root/root. > > > > I have attached a patch that patches the template files for the start > > scripts , so that the daemons are started correctly. > > Can you make a try to add the -u and -g option to the startproc program > instead of the bacula daemon? > > When you have a problem such as a segfault, the process can't attach gdb to > itself because the uid/gid changed from root to a normal user (ptrace > problem). > > I don't know if suse has this problem or not, can you try the backtrace > generation with a simple kill -ABRT $(pidof bacula-dir) ? You should find > the backtrace file somewhere with full information.
Philipp, I concur with Eric. The change you proposed will not work. One cannot fix the problem at installation time. It must be fixed when Bacula begins execution, and in some cases the problem may be more fundamental because log files and cons files can be created at any time while Bacula is running. This may require a change to the permissions/group of the directories themselves.
